Background and Achievements
The Al-Nasr women’s football team was established in 2018 as the female counterpart of the club where Cristiano Ronaldo currently plays in the Saudi Pro League. As many fans worldwide found out in the meantime, Al-Nasr is one of the country’s oldest and most prestigious football squads.
The team was formed as a response to more and more women interested in professional sports and participation in competitive leagues. Since Saudi Arabia has made constant progress regarding women’s rights, establishing the team was another step toward equality. The team’s mission is to promote women’s football in the country and create more opportunities for females to showcase their talent for club and country.
Al-Nasr’s women’s team has claimed two trophies in its short history. They won the inaugural edition of the 2021/2022 SAFF Women’s National Football Championship. Not only that Al-Nasr won all their eight matches in the championship, but they did so by scoring a total of 31 goals while only conceding three. The hard work, determination, team spirit, and constant support from their fans pushed the girls toward the trophy.
After the previous success, the team continued to write history by winning the first edition of the Saudi Women’s Premier League earlier this year. After 14 matches played, Al-Nasr collected 35 points and took the first position with a 3-point lead over Al-Hilal, their rivals from Riyadh. In the final round, Al-Nasr got a 3-2 victory over Al Yamamah, while Al-Hilal only managed a 4-4 draw with Ittihad to give the champions an ever bigger gap.
Overall, in the 2022/2023 first season of the Premier League, the team won 11 out of the 14 matches played. Two other games ended in a draw, and the only team capable of beating the champions was Al-Hilal in the 10th round after an away game that ended 6-3 for the runner-up. The team’s record in other competitions has also been impressive.
They won the 2020 Arab Women’s Sports Tournament, beating teams from across the Middle East, and finished as runners-up in the 2019 edition of the Arab Women’s Champions League. The team’s success has put them on the map and earned them respect and recognition from fans and fellow players worldwide.
Massive Impact on Society
The Al-Nasr women’s football team’s success has had a profound impact on Saudi Arabian and Gulf society, challenging traditional gender roles and inspiring women and girls to participate in sports. The team’s achievements have shown that women can excel in football and compete at the highest level and that sports should not be limited to men.
The team has also helped to break down stereotypes and dispel myths about women’s abilities and interests. Many young girls have been inspired by the team’s success and have started playing football themselves, either in school or at local clubs. The team has also raised awareness about women’s rights and gender equality, showing that women can be empowered and achieve success in all areas of life.
The Future of Women’s Soccer in Saudi Arabia and the Gulf Region
Besides the team’s stunning success in its initial years, Al-Nasr also started a sustained movement across the Arab world. The establishment of the Saudi Women’s Football League and the Arab Women’s Sports Tournament are examples of the growing interest and support for women’s football in the region.
However, there is still much work to be done to promote and develop women’s football. There is a need for more investment in facilities, coaching, and training programs for women’s football, as well as greater awareness and promotion of women’s sports in general.
